Common Spider Pests in Livingston and Surrounding Areas

The climate and abundant natural surroundings in Livingston contribute to the prevalence of several common spider species. Understanding these pests is the first step in effective control.

Identifying Local Spider Threats

In Livingston and nearby communities like Millburn and West Orange, several spider types are commonly encountered in and around residential and commercial properties. These often include:

  • **House Spiders:** These are perhaps the most common, weaving webs in corners, undisturbed areas, and entry points of homes.
  • **Cellar Spiders (Daddy Longlegs):** Easily recognizable by their long, slender legs, these spiders are often found in basements, garages, and damp areas.
  • **Wolf Spiders:** These active hunters are typically found on the ground and are often mistaken for more dangerous species by homeowners.
  • **Jumping Spiders:** Small and often brightly colored, these spiders are known for their excellent vision and ability to jump considerable distances.

While the Black Widow, a venomous species, is not as commonly found in indoor environments in New Jersey as some other regions, it can inhabit outdoor structures like woodpiles, sheds, and undisturbed gardening areas, posing a potential concern for residents in areas with more extensive natural landscapes.

How to spot spiders in Livingston

Common signs of spiders in the Livingston area homes: webs in corners, eaves, or basements, egg sacs attached to webs in sheltered spots, and more sightings indoors in fall as spiders seek warmth. Spotting these early makes treatment faster and less disruptive.

How Spider Control works in Livingston

A professional Spider Control in Livingston typically means eliminating webs and egg sacs, perimeter and harborage-area spraying, reducing exterior lighting that attracts prey insects, and sealing entry gaps. Locally, most spiders are harmless, but brown recluse and black widow bites require medical attention — and both are more common in cluttered or undisturbed spaces in older homes.

Local spiders timing

Spiders are most visible in the Livingston area in late summer and fall as they seek warmth and mates indoors.

Livingston prevention tips

To keep spiders from returning in the Livingston area: seal gaps around windows and pipes, reduce clutter in storage areas, and cut or switch exterior lighting to minimize the prey insects that attract spiders.

Can I treat spiders myself in Livingston?

Store-bought products can help somewhat, but often fall short — contact sprays kill on-contact but spiders quickly avoid treated surfaces; a pro addresses the harborage areas and cuts back the prey-insect population that attracts them. Getting a pro in means treating the source, not just what you can see.

Who handles spiders treatment costs in Livingston?

For renters in Livingston: New Jersey's warranty of habitability generally makes the landlord responsible for treating spiders not caused by the tenant — put any notice in writing. spiders entering through structural gaps are a building-maintenance pest issue; a recurring infestation driven by structural conditions is a landlord habitability concern.
